Thank you very much for taking care of us during our 4-night Multiple Night Stay. This time, we stayed in the “Oryu” Room. First of all, every staff member was incredibly kind and clearly loves animals. Everyone greeted us with a smile, was gentle and attentive, brought anything we needed right away, and did their best to accommodate our requests. I’m truly grateful—your staff deserves more than five stars. Next, the meals. We were told they were prepared in a special-suite style, and both the taste and quality were excellent—high standard, delicious, and thoughtfully varied. Even over several days, we never got tired of them and enjoyed every meal. With longer stays, menus can sometimes become difficult for the kitchen side as well, but you handled everything so carefully. Since I’m also a small eater, you kindly let me choose from the menu and adjusted portion sizes accordingly. This also deserves more than five stars. As mentioned earlier, your care for animals was also very thoughtful and helpful. I visited with both a dog and a cat, and it seemed comfortable for both of them. The hot spring water quality was also wonderful. As for the guest room layout: there is a long corridor between the Room area and the bath area, which felt slightly inconvenient, so I deducted one star there. On the other hand, having an additional Room separate from the main living space made it easy to stay comfortably even when traveling with friends—an excellent design. Regarding amenities: there are no pet amenities provided (so bringing your own is necessary), but having at least a litter box available would be very helpful. The surroundings were also fantastic—like a hidden mountain hamlet. By chance we were able to see “Children’s Kagura,” which has deep history and is clearly cherished by the community. The performers practice extensively (twice a week), and while they are indeed children (apparently ranging from 3rd grade elementary school to 3rd year high school), their performance was outstanding and truly impressive. If your dates happen to coincide with it during your stay nearby, it’s absolutely worth seeing. (It seems Kagura is held several times a year; I’d love to see other performances as well.) I also felt that preserving traditional Japanese festivals like this is part of what makes this area so special—and I think it may become even more well-known in the future. It’s about 30 minutes by car to Yufuin Station, so even on an extended stay you can easily go shopping for necessities. Sightseeing around Yufuin should be convenient as well—and Beppu is also about 30 minutes away via expressway—so overall it feels like an excellent location for travelers who want to explore.

I was in Atami for work for the first time in a while, and I wanted to enjoy an Onsen, so after looking around I chose this place. From Atami Station to the nearest station, Imaihama-Kaigan Station, it takes about 1 hour and 30 minutes via the Ito Line and Izukyu Line, and it’s about a 3-minute walk from Imaihama-Kaigan Station to the Ryokan—very convenient. Rather than a typical Ryokan, it truly feels like a hideaway, just as the name Ittoan suggests. The lighting is kept slightly dim, creating a calm atmosphere. Dinner was served in a bright private dining room, and the contrast between light and shadow was wonderful. The staff member in charge—who said they started working here five months ago—explained each dish and kindly chatted with us for a while. There were many dishes, all delicious of course, but what impressed me most was the simmered splendid alfonsino served as a whole fish; it was my first time seeing it like that, and both the presentation and taste were unforgettable. They recommended rice porridge as a late-night meal, but I was far too full this time. I could use a private open-air bath for 50 minutes free of charge; I chose “Akibiyori” and was surprised by how spacious it was and how many trees surrounded it. If you think of the open-air bath area as the first floor, there is an upper level that feels like a reclining bath area on the second floor, so I could enjoy going back and forth between them. It felt more spacious than the large public bath area (ofuro), allowing me to fully relax. Breakfast was also luxurious. Both dinner and breakfast are Japanese-style meals with some Western touches, which I really liked. The Room was spacious, Wi-Fi worked without needing a password, completely stress-free. Everything—absolutely everything—was wonderful here, but above all else، the staff’s courteous yet friendly manner truly reflects what makes this inn special. Unfortunately it was cloudy with rain during my stay، so as I boarded my train home، I promised myself I would return next time under clear blue skies.
